Africa’s Resource Wealth Ignites Global Competition for Development

Africa’s vast natural resources are attracting intense interest from nations and corporations worldwide, igniting a fierce competition for access and control. With rich deposits of minerals, oil, and natural gas, the continent is increasingly recognized as a cornerstone for global economic growth. Countries such as China, the United States, and members of the European Union are vying for partnerships that promise not only material wealth but also geopolitical influence. Key resources fueling this competition include:

  • Minerals: Lithium, cobalt, and rare earth elements critical for technology and electronics.
  • Energy: Vast oil reserves in Nigeria and Libya, along with burgeoning natural gas discoveries in Mozambique and Tanzania.
  • Agriculture: Fertile land for food production, with potential to become the world’s breadbasket.

As the race accelerates, the potential benefits for African nations are immense, but so are the challenges. Governments must navigate complex relationships with foreign entities to ensure that their populations benefit from resource exploitation. This imperative has prompted many nations to adopt policies aimed at maximizing local content in resource extraction industries. For instance, a growing number of countries are implementing strategies to:

  • Boost local employment: By mandating that firms hire and train local workers.
  • Enhance infrastructure: Using resource revenues to build essential facilities.
  • Support education: Investing in skills training that empowers the youth.
